Summary/Objective
Assist the Resource Analyst with survey tasks including, but not limited to, processing mail, data entry, draft protocols, recordkeeping, and survey design. Additionally, this position supervises the daily tasks of up to four (4) other hourly, part-time positions (data entry technicians).
Please note: this position is funded for 38 hours/week.
Essential Job Duties
- Deliver and pick-up survey or cover letter templates, survey or cover letter proofs, and finished survey materials to/from OA Document Solutions, MDC Distribution/Print Shop, MDC Headquarters, mailing service provider, USDA, USPS, and Resource Analyst as needed.
- Deliver checks to mailing service provider, USDA, and USPS for rendered services as needed.
- Sort, process, and document mail items returned to the Social Science Program, including identifying and readdressing surveys with a change of address label.
- Unfold, batch, and otherwise prepare returned surveys for data entry and verification by the team.
- Draft, edit, and update protocols to guide task completion by the Survey Shop team. Protocols include, but are not limited to mail sorting and processing, survey data entry and verification, and other tasks.
- Lead and direct Survey Shop team daily tasks and priorities.
- Train other team members on written protocols for Survey Shop tasks, including sorting/processing mail, batching surveys, and data entry and verification.
- Maintain Survey Shop organization by keeping individual project materials and supplies separate, well-ordered, and easy to find.
